A REVIEW ON HPLC METHOD FOR ESTIMATION OF AZELNIDIPINE
Krishnaphanisri Ponnekanti*, Addanki Anusha, Malavika Reddy and Omkar H.
. Abstract Hypertension, also known as high blood pressure, occurs when the force of blood against the artery walls is too high. Azelnidipine (AZEL) is a dihydropyridine (DHP) type of calcium channel blocker (CCB) used for the treatment of hypertension. AZEL has two enantiomers due to an asymmetric carbon at 4th position of the DHP ring. The pharmacological action of AZEL resides in (R) - enantiomer and biological activity resides in (S) – enantiomer. High-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C) is a type of column chromatography that is commonly used in biochemistry and analysis to separate, identify, and quantify active chemicals. A new simple, accurate and precise HPLC method has been developed and validated for estimation of Azelnidipine in its formulation. It is one of the most accurate methods widely used for the quantitative as well as qualitative analysis of drug product and is used for determining drug product stability.
